Sencore 3-Day Hands-On
LCD Troubleshooting and Calibration Tech School

WHAT YOU'LL LEARN: This comprehensive hands-on program covers troubleshooting and calibration concepts and techniques for LCD display types using SC3100, PSL60, VP401, LC103, and CP5000U. The class teaches familiarity with switch mode power supplies and LCD Inverter power supply operation and troubleshooting. You are taught multi-mode formats, circuit operation, analog (RGB), and digital signal formats and connectors (DVI). The training explains theory and operation of fixed pixel displays, including LCD panel operation, signal processing, and backlighting is explained.

Day 1 - Equipment Familiarization/LCD Displays
The course begins with equipment familiarization and an overview of LCD displays. Students will discover how LCD panels work by learning the major functional blocks of an LCD monitor. Sencore has developed specific LCD trainers for hands-on demonstrations and troubleshooting exercises.

Day 2 - Hands-on LCD Monitor Troubleshooting
The second day of this course provides an introduction to troubleshooting LCD monitors. Entry level technicians and seasoned veterans will learn troubleshooting techniques and short cuts by using block diagrams and hands-on lab exercises.

Day 3 - LCD Inverter power supply and SMPS Troubleshooting
The last day of the course provides an introduction to power supplies and their uses. The students then learn how each type of SMPS and inverter power supply works by performing experiments on a working model. This course is truly a hands-on course with approximately 70% devoted to lab time performing tests utilizing an exclusive Sencore power supply trainer.
